Consider factors like a road style and price range before making a desired investment .Lowering Your E46: Coilovers vs. SpringsSo, you're wanting reduce the profile of your E46? Fantastic! You've got two main options: coilovers or performance springs. Lowering springs are generally the more budget-friendly option , and provide a noticeable difference in appearance. They’re quite simple to install , but give little adjustability. Adjustable suspension systems , on the other hand , are a more significant upgrade, permitting you to fine-tune your ride characteristics and attain a truly feel. They frequently demand professional fitting . Ultimately, the best path relies on your budget and preferred level of adjustability. Springs: Economical , easier setup, restricted adjustability. Coilovers: Expanded adjustability, increased cost , expert installation suggested .Maximize Your BMW E46 's Handling with Performance Coilovers To really refine your BMW E46 's road behavior, consider upgraded coilovers.
